Disruptive Forces in the Supply Chain: Firsthand Experiences & Innovative Solutions

February 6, 2019 | 4:30-6:30 p.m. | 1 CPE | Whitley Penn office
Kevin Kieffer, VP of Sales and Marketing at Encore Wire Corp., and Frank Bilban, VP and CFO at Encore Wire Corp., will discuss various disruptive forces and their effect on the current overall supply chain. They will provide real world examples and insights on new technologies and methods that Encore Wire Corp. and other companies are using to effectively utilize their supply chain.
Kevin Kieffer, VP of Sales & Marketing, Encore Wire Corporation
Frank Bilban, VP & CFO, Encore Wire Corporation

Learning Objectives:  Discuss the emerging trends and disruptions in the supply chain Innovative solutions for solving supply chain disruptions Understanding the potential future that lies ahead for supply chain logistics
